One of the most usual applications of rubber plugs is in the vehicle sector, where they serve an important feature in lorry assembly and maintenance. For instance, rubber plugs are usually employed to seal openings and dental caries in car bodies, thus stopping dust, water, and other pollutants from getting in delicate locations. This not only assists keep the visual allure of the vehicle but also plays a considerable function in protecting its mechanical honesty. In addition, rubber plugs are made use of to prevent fluid leakage in engines, fuel storage tanks, and other systems, guaranteeing ideal efficiency and security. Their capacity to hold up against harsh conditions and high temperatures makes them especially fit for auto applications.
In pipes, rubber plugs are essential for preventing leakages and making certain the reliable operation of water supply. They can be made use of as drainpipe plugs, sealing sinks or bath tubs while these components are being serviced or cleaned up. Rubber plugs likewise act as important components in various sorts of installations and shutoffs, where they can assist control the flow of water and other fluids. The flexibility of rubber permits these plugs to develop a tight seal, reducing the risk of leaks that can lead to significant water damages. In addition, rubber's capacity to withstand rust from various cleaning chemicals enhances the usefulness of rubber plugs in pipes applications.
In the clinical market, rubber plugs play an equally vital function, particularly in the design and manufacture of clinical gadgets and pharmaceutical packaging. When it comes to vials made use of for keeping liquids, rubber plugs work as seals to preserve the sterility and integrity important kept within. They avoid contamination and ensure that medical products remain reliable for longer periods. Additionally, these rubber seals are designed to be penetrated by needles without jeopardizing the vacuum within, which is vital for drawing fluid from vials. This development of rubber plugs in the medical area represents a mix of development and necessity, making sure patient security and product integrity.

The manufacturing process of rubber connects entails several steps, which can vary based on the details needs of the application. Many rubber plugs are generated making use of mold manufacturing methods which permit precise dimensions and surfaces. The products chosen for these plugs can vary significantly relying on their planned use. Natural rubber offers terrific flexibility, while artificial rubbers, such as silicone or neoprene, give unique residential properties, consisting of resistance to oils, chemicals, warmth, and UV light. Each type of rubber presents its own set of qualities that need to be straightened with the end-user's demands, making the selection of the ideal rubber substance an important aspect of developing rubber plugs.
While rubber plugs can be extremely resilient, depending on their application, most will certainly have a suggested lifespan. Sectors commonly replace rubber plugs throughout set up maintenance to avoid the failings that can occur from material exhaustion, which might lead to leaks or failures.
